Product reviews:
Watch Free Live Streaming Sports Online free sports live stream sites
free sports live stream sites
Tyler
2025-12-10 iphone 6s Plus
15 Best Sports Streaming Sites Free free sports live stream sites
free sports live stream sites
Jesse
2025-12-17 iphone SE
Free Live Sport Streaming Sites - wenew free sports live stream sites
free sports live stream sites